Actuators in an aircraft play a critical role in converting energy into motion and are commonly associated with the movement of various parts of the aircraft. When considering the attachment of actuators, the most relevant answer is the aircraft structure.

The actuators are typically mounted on or integrated within the aircraft structure to facilitate interaction with control surfaces, landing gear, and other mechanical components. The structure provides the necessary foundation and support for the actuators to perform their functions effectively. For example, in the case of flight control systems, actuators are often attached within the structures that house the control surfaces, allowing them to operate efficiently while ensuring structural integrity during flight.

While other options, such as control surfaces and various systems, may also involve the use of actuators, the term "aircraft structure" encompasses the broader framework that physically supports the possibility of integrating actuators into multiple systems throughout the aircraft. Understanding this relationship highlights the importance of the aircraft's design in accommodating and optimizing actuator performance within the overall system.
